#64586b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64586b is composed of 39.2% red, 34.5%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 277.9 degrees, a saturation of 9.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#64586b color hex could be obtained by blending #c8b0d6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#64586b color description : Very dark grayish violet.
#64586b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64586b has RGB values of R:100, G:88,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6576235.

Shades and Tints of #64586b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09080a is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#64586b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626064 is the less saturated color, while #7a05be is the most saturated one.
